JOB SUMMARY
Under the general direction of the Director of Sales, the Business Development Specialist is responsible for building relationships with existing and potential clients within a specified region and/or industry, resulting in business expansion and increased sales.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
- Cultivate strong, collaborative relationships with clients, helping them to achieve their business goals through services Microbac offers
- Develop and execute business plans resulting in the growth in sales revenue
- Maintain up to date knowledge and understanding of industry trends, conditions, regulatory requirements, and competitors’ pricing, and other factors that may influence customers in order to present them with honest and accurate value propositions that favor utilizing our services
- Work closely with members of the sales team and laboratory technical staff to understand current and future service offerings and capabilities
- Increase sales revenue through the development and execution of business/sales plans
- Establish a positive rapport with clients and work closely with them to understand their needs
- Work collaboratively with internal Customer Relationship team, ensuring the needs of our clients are being met
- Develop and maintain thorough understanding of the assigned territory and industry
- Leverage knowledge of clients, industry trends, and changes to proactively anticipate and address the needs of clients
- Collaborate with technical and marketing teams to create marketing materials and presentations targeted to specific industries and clients
- Utilize CRM software and other resources to identify and connect with clients
- Manage personal work expenses effectively and within budget
- Travel efficiently and safely throughout assigned region
- Perform administrative duties, such as preparing sales reports and quotes, maintaining sales records, etc.
- Maintain current and complete files on all clients and client contacts
- Maintain a high level of client contact
M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S
- Bachelor’s degree with a concentration in business or science as it relates to the industry
- Minimum 1 year of industry experience (i.e.; FDA or EPA regulations/requirements)
- Prior B2B sales experience and customer service experience
- Excellent communication and presentation skills and abilities
- Confidence leading meetings and negotiations
- Ability to understand and align the needs of others with company services and present compelling value propositions
- Residence within the communicated territory/region or willingness to relocate
- General understanding of the targeted industry
- Acceptable driving record
